MOL adds wood chip carrier to fleet

Baird Maritime

Mitsui OSK Lines (MOL) took delivery of a new bulk carrier from Imabari Shipbuilding on Tuesday, February 8.

Stellar Symphony will be used by MOL to transport wood chips for Marusumi Paper Company under a long-term charter.

The newbuild measures 199.96 by 32.24 metres and has a total cargo capacity of approximately 102,600 cubic metres.

The ship is also equipped with a microplastic recovery system that uses a filter with a backwash function to efficiently collect microplastics that have been repaired in the filter before they are discharged overboard. This recovery system is part of the ballast water management system.
